Citroën 2CV camshaft analyzer 🚗
This article describes the development of a connected test bench designed to analyze the camshafts of Citroën 2CV cars. The project involves both hardware and software components to ensure precise measurements and data analysis.
Project Overview Link to heading
The Citroën 2CV camshaft analyzer is a specialized tool developed to test and validate the camshafts of the iconic Citroën 2CV. The project was initiated to address the need for a reliable and efficient method to analyze camshaft performance, ensuring the longevity and reliability of these classic vehicles.
Key Features Link to heading
- Connected Test Bench: The analyzer is equipped with sensors and connectivity features to collect and transmit data in real-time.
- Precision Measurement: Utilizes high-precision tools to ensure accurate readings.
- Data Analysis: Includes software for detailed analysis of camshaft performance.
